A variety of carbide tipped tri-cone roller, or finger bits can be found which penetrate by using “grinding and shattering” mechanisms. Rotary drills equipped with continuous flight augers typically are accustomed to progress uncased holes in smooth rocks or soils.

Geotechnical drilling is the whole process of drilling into your earth to gather soil and rock samples, which happen to be then analyzed to determine the Bodily and chemical properties of the subsurface.

These info details are coupled with numerical modeling and engineering judgements to inform the look, design and servicing of latest developments and present assets.

Geotechnical engineers examine the stability of pure and made slopes and constructions and examine soil and rock circumstances by drilling, sampling, and tests.

Geotechnical engineers are the experts who interpret the info received from geotechnical drilling tasks. They evaluate the soil and rock samples, understanding the properties and ailments. This Investigation is vital in developing foundations, predicting and mitigating possible floor actions, and making sure that any development follows safety restrictions.
